Показать сообщение отдельно
  #8 (permalink)  
Старый 27.01.2010, 14:10
Аватар для Niar
Труъ кодер
Отправить личное сообщение для Niar Посмотреть профиль Найти все сообщения от Niar
 
Регистрация: 20.01.2010
Сообщений: 194

function err(e){throw e}
a = prompt('Введите "ошибка"');

try {
 try {
     err(a);
  } 
finally{
alert("Финалли");
}
}  
catch (e) {
if (e=='ошибка') alert('детектед ошибка');
 }

Почему тут срабатывает внешний catch?
__________________
http://www.free-lance.ru/users/Nia173 Мой аккуант на free-lance.

Последний раз редактировалось Niar, 27.01.2010 в 14:15.
Ответить с цитированием